Do You Know The Difference Between Onsite And Offsite SEO?

Onsite and offsite search engine optimisation (SEO), otherwise known as Onsite and Offsite SEO, are the two critical components of the SEO process. For higher rankings and maximum exposure to the search engine results page (SERPs) you need to understand the difference between the two and how to utilise them. There is no point in having a website if people can’t find it.

Onsite SEO is what you do to make your website search engine friendly and easy to find.

On the other hand, Offsite SEO looks at how authoritative and popular your site is by incorporating sites that link back to yours. These concepts are the building blocks you need to create an excellent website that can be easily found.

Consider SEO as having your business in the best location on the busiest street – if your website is ranking well (ideally on page 1) your business will get the most traffic and, in turn, the most potential customers.

What Is Onsite SEO?

Onsite SEO consists of adjusting certain elements on your website so that search engines can easily understand and crawl the content on your site.

The more data and information they can get from your site to understand the intent of your content, the greater your chances of ranking above competitors. Improving and fixing potential problems related to on-page SEO is the first step you should take when optimising your website for search engines such as Google.

Search engines reward easily readable websites with higher rankings on the search index. Many critical components of onsite SEO are the foundation for improving page rank in your specific industry. These are:

  • Content
  • Keywords
  • Headings
  • URL structure
  • Page load speed
  • Inbound links
  • Image alt tags
  • Mobile friendliness
  • Fulfilling the Core Web Vitals

What Is Offsite SEO?

Offsite SEO includes the tasks you do outside of your site besides advertising. Offsite SEO is the concept of having other sites link back to yours, indicating that you have authority in your industry and online.

The best methods to develop offsite SEO include:

  • Sharable content – create and post engaging content users will share.
  • Conduct in-depth research, surveys or polls – citations for statistical content is another excellent way to generate backlinks.
  • Social media – keep active on social media to engage people and promote activity on your page.
  • Add your website to online directories – for the most part this is free and a great way to get started in building backlinks.
  • Guest blogging – writing a blog for someone who is an authority in your industry is an excellent way to get exposure and generate a quality backlink back to your website.

Is Onsite Or Offsite SEO More Important?

Both types of SEO are essential to search engines. The most important aspect of your overall SEO strategy is thorough research to ensure that you compete for the right keywords, target market and adequate audience attention.
